Chapter 23: Almost Lucky

When Shen Zhuying sat back down beside Fu Sizhuo, her eyes were still red.

Fu Sizhuo glanced at her. He didn’t quite understand this baffling kind of emotion between women, yet he silently peeled a candy and held it by her lips. “Open your mouth.”

Shen Zhuying instinctively opened her mouth and bit the candy.

A rich milky sweetness filled her mouth.

It was a milk-flavored candy. Shen Zhuying sniffled, her voice still a little choked. “Thank you.”

As the host’s words on stage began the ceremony, Li Ning, dressed in a pure white wedding gown, holding a round bouquet of calla lilies, walked slowly toward the groom on her father’s arm.

At first, Shen Zhuying managed to stay composed, still smiling. But when Li Ning, through tears, uttered that line—“I do”—for some reason, Shen Zhuying’s tears began flowing uncontrollably.

A hand stretched out beside her, quietly offering a tissue.

Shen Zhuying took it and wiped her tears. On stage, Li Ning and Zhuang Xuzhi began exchanging rings, vowing to spend their lives together.

They had met at the age of five, secretly gotten together at sixteen without anyone knowing, entered the same university at eighteen, and gotten engaged at twenty-two.

Finally, now at twenty-six, they were married.

And below the stage, Fu Sizhuo took her hand, stroking it ever so lightly, ever so gently.

“Shen Zhuying, don’t cry.”

He tried to coax her with a clumsy yet slightly helpless tone.

“Fu Sizhuo.” Shen Zhuying gripped his hand in return, her clear eyes looking at him.

“Let’s hold our wedding in the spring next year.”

Spring was the season when everything came alive.

Warm, vibrant, full of energy.

She wanted to use every beautiful word she could think of to describe spring.

Precisely because of that, of course she wanted to meet all beautiful people and things in spring.

“Alright.”

Fu Sizhuo raised his hand, gently wiping the tears from the corner of her eyes.

He wanted to kiss the tears from her eyes.

But he feared startling her.

When it came time to toss the bouquet, the round calla lily bouquet drew an arc through the air and landed straight in Pei Qian’s hands.

Pei Qian held the bouquet and, smiling, waved at Shen Zhuying.

Shen Zhuying felt very happy.

Pei Qian’s college boyfriend had been in a long-distance relationship with her for three years, but in the end, their love couldn’t withstand the distance, they broke up last year.

She hoped this bouquet could bring good luck to Pei Qian.

Whether in career or in love.

As the banquet was drawing to an end, Li Xu suggested they gather once more at the place they often went to during their school days. She had already gotten her visa to the United States, and it would probably be hard for them to meet again in the future.

So Shen Zhuying tilted her head and said to Fu Sizhuo in a slightly apologetic voice,
“Fu Sizhuo, you go ahead first. I still want to go with Qian Qian and the others to our old spot for a get-together.”

“Which old spot?”

Shen Zhuying had drunk a little wine during the banquet, and her mind was somewhat sluggish at this moment.
“It’s just… that old spot we often went to in college.”

Fu Sizhuo patiently asked, “Then what’s the name of the place you often went to in college?”

Shen Zhuying blinked. “The place we often went to in college was… Qingcheng Bar.”

Fu Sizhuo’s long eyes narrowed. “Qingcheng Bar?”

Shen Zhuying nodded, folding her hands in front of her, looking completely honest. “We’d order male models.”

“…”

“Madam Fu’s college life was quite… colorful.” Fu Sizhuo’s tone was cool, with the hint of a smile that wasn’t quite a smile.
“Change the place. I’ll take you there.”

Shen Zhuying shook her head. “I just want to go to Qingcheng Bar.”

“Shen. Zhu. Ying.” The man called her name, enunciating each word.

“What?” Shen Zhuying puffed out her cheeks.

“…”

In the end, they still went to Qingcheng Bar.

Li Xu and Pei Qian sat trembling in the back seat, feeling the whole car filled with a chilling atmosphere.

Another car followed behind them, it was the groom driving, with the bride inside.

Originally, Li Xu’s idea was that the three of them could just gather at Qingcheng Bar. Who would have thought that after seeing the group messages, Li Ning also wanted to come.

So what was supposed to be a group of three turned into a group of six.

In truth, though Qingcheng Bar had a rather wild-sounding name, it was actually a very proper, serious lounge bar.

The owner had once been a soldier, and since it was near the university district, the most basic safety was still guaranteed.

Once Fu Sizhuo realized this, his expression visibly softened.

“Little liar.” He lowered his voice, leaned close, and whispered in Shen Zhuying’s ear.

Ordering male models, clearly nonsense.

“Heehee.” Shen Zhuying smiled ingratiatingly and shook his hand.

Inside the private room, the four girls skillfully ordered a few bottles of alcohol and some snacks.

Then four heads turned in unison toward the only two men in the room.

“You two… are also planning to join our girls’ dorm party?” Li Ning was the first to gently voice it.

Among women, there were many topics that men couldn’t be around to hear.

“Wife.” Zhuang Xuzhi looked at Li Ning, his tone carrying a bit of pitiful pleading.

“Tonight is our wedding night.”

Are we even going home tonight, wife?

“Don’t worry, we know our limits. We won’t make your wife wait too long. We’ll just borrow her for two hours.” Pei Qian raised two fingers.

“You two go play in the private room next door for two hours and then come back.”

Fu Sizhuo tilted his head, staring at Shen Zhuying’s flushed cheeks. He wanted to remind her of a few things, but after thinking it over, he let it go.

Forget it, he shouldn’t restrain her too much.

After all, he was right next door, keeping an eye on her anytime.

The moment Fu Sizhuo and Zhuang Xuzhi stepped out of the private room, Shen Zhuying was immediately surrounded by the other three.

“What’s going on, Shen Zhuzhu? Why did you suddenly have a flash marriage with him?”

Shen Zhuying cracked open a bottle, took a slow sip. “Well, that’s… a long story.”

The other three said in unison: “Then make a long story short!!!”

Ten years, long if you put it that way. But the intersections between her and Fu Sizhuo were far too few.

So few that Shen Zhuying finished telling it all in less than ten minutes.

“Oh my god, my Shen Zhuzhu.” Pei Qian downed an entire bottle in one go, then cupped Shen Zhuying’s face with a heartache-filled expression.

“You actually spent all that time just doing unrequited love with this face of yours?”

Only heaven knew how stunned Pei Qian had been the first time she saw Shen Zhuying.

Even now, seven or eight years later, she could still recall how she looked back then. The rest of the dorm girls had basically all arrived, but since they weren’t familiar with each other, the three of them only offered awkward greetings and then had nothing else to say.

And just then, Shen Zhuying had rushed in holding an enormous bouquet of blazing yellow roses.

“Hello, I’m Shen Zhuying.”

She split the roses into four portions, handing them out one by one while chattering on, “Please take care of me for the next four years of college.”

When she handed them to Pei Qian, her eyes curved into little crescent moons, livelier and more charming than even the yellow roses in her arms.

“I never planned on having some one-sided crush.” Shen Zhuying let out a sigh.
“It’s just that every time I was about to catch up to him, I always seemed to be short on a bit of luck.”

In high school, Shen Zhuying’s grades were below average. But knowing his target university was Huada, she pushed herself desperately, and her grades gradually climbed into the top twenty of the year.

Unfortunately, when the college entrance exam results came out, she was still short by two points.

She repeated a year, and finally got into Huada as she wished, only to hear that he had transferred to England half a year earlier.
